Chinook Landing Marine Park is a 67-acre marine park with six launching lanes on the Columbia River. It is one of the largest public boating facilities in Oregon. The park offers picnic and viewing areas, wetland and wildlife habitat, disabled-accessible docks, restrooms and a seasonal river patrol station.
Bring your annual pass for admission to the marine park or pay $5 per vehicle. MasterCard or Visa only; cash and checks not accepted.
